What side of the road do they drive on in La Jana?
In La Jana, you’ll have to stick to the right-hand side. When exploring a new place, it’s always a smart idea to select an automatic car. That way, you can focus on the road and not worry about gear changes.

Are there speed limits in La Jana?
There sure are. In the city of La Jana, speed limits range from 50km/h to 120km/h. Most built-up areas have a default speed limit of 50km/h unless otherwise indicated.
What happens if I get a speeding fine while driving a rental car in Baix Maestrat?
Normally, one of two things will happen. Your chosen rental car company may charge the amount of the fine to your credit card. This is the more common practice. On the other hand, it may supply your contact information to local authorities so the fine is sent directly to you.
Is it illegal to use a cell phone while driving in La Jana?
It is against the law to use your cell phone while driving in La Jana, and you could also be hit with a fine for just handling a phone when you’re in control of a vehicle. That said, the use of hands-free or Bluetooth functions is permitted, as long as you keep your attention on the road.
What are the rules around drink driving in La Jana?
While behind the wheel in La Jana, it’s illegal to have a BAC (blood alcohol content) greater than 0.05%. Thinking of having a few beers over lunch or dinner? Consider taking a taxi or using a ride-sharing service.
Is turning on a red light allowed in La Jana?
Turning on a red light is prohibited in La Jana. Be on the lookout for traffic signs and lights so that you don’t break any traffic laws.
Are seat belts compulsory in Baix Maestrat?
Seat belts must be worn in Baix Maestrat. However, these rules may vary for some vehicles, like those used by public transportation networks.
